0

我现在有一个令我困惑的问题。我有一个用于在页面上发布帖子和上传图片的表单。该页面根据从数据库中检索到的用户填充不同的用户信息。该表单适用于一个配置文件,但不会显示在任何其他配置文件上,这让我感到困惑为什么会发生这种情况。这是表格:

<form enctype="multipart/form-data" name='newPost-<?=$username?>' method='post' action='utilities/newWallPost.php'>
    < textarea name="postText"></textarea>
    < br />
    < input type='file' id='upload' name='upload[]' multiple=""/>
    < input type='hidden' name='recipient' value='<?=$username?>'/>
    < input type='submit' value='Post' name='btn_upload'/>
    < /div>
    < div id="newPost">
        < a href="#" id="newPostLink">Create new post</a>
< /form>

有没有人有什么建议?起初我认为这是表单的命名约定,所以我将其设置为将用户名附加到表单名称,但由于某种原因它仍然没有显示。

编辑:附加信息,当我尝试在未显示实际表单标签的配置文件上提交表单(显示其输入)时,系统尝试访问同一页面(而不是实用程序/wallNewWallPost .php)。奇怪的。

4

1 回答 1

0

我将您输入的上述代码复制到一个新的 .html 文档中,但该表单未显示。

我相信由于标签中的空格,表格无法正常工作。

所以我稍微修改了一下,它对我有用: link here

于 2012-06-09T20:08:44.887 回答